Arsenal Regret Drawing 1-1 to Everton as Liverpool Drop 3 Points Against Fulham

Arsenal will blame itself for not narrowing the gap against the League leaders, Liverpool by not securing three points against Everton. The Gunners were in total control of the game but dropped two crucial points in the second half of the game.

Arsenal really controlled the game and had a lot of chances that were missed. The introduction of Bukayo Saka and Gabriel Martinelli still did not have any effect in the game. The game ended in a 1-1 draw.

Liverpool on the other hand, suffered a major blow and lost three crucial points despite the fact that they are the ones who scored first. Ryan Gravenberch gave Alexis Mac Allister a good pass and the Argentine international player scored the opening goal of the game.

Fulham then answered the blow with three quick successive goals from Ryan Sessegnon, Alex Iwobi and Rodrigo Muniz. Fulham scored all the three goals in the first half. Liverpool tried their best to even get a draw but all that they could achieve was just another goal from Luis Diaz who got an assist from Conor Bradley.

If Arsenal could have done their part and won the game, then the difference between Liverpool and Arsenal could have just been nine points. These are very few points because they are just three games.

Arsenal could have also made sure that they win their remaining match against Liverpool so that they can even further narrow down the points. The difference between the two clubs is now 11 points which seem to be so much because Arsenal too did not take its chances very well.

There is a lot of regret in the Arsenal camp right now because they failed to deliver when they were needed to deliver. This is the point and time when they need to win all their matches and hope that Liverpool will stumble and lose some of its matches and also draw some of its matches.
